Scatter: Odyssey characters and gods/goddesses

Aesop
former slave who uses the fable as a means of political and social criticism
Zeus
king of the heavens
Hera
goddess of home and hearth
Poseidon
god of the sea
Hades
god of the underworld
Athena
goddess of wisdom
Hermes
messenger god
Ares
war god
Aphrodite
goddess of love
Paris and the Golden Apple
Paris gave the golden apple to Aphrodite and won Helen of Troy
Homer
writer of the Iliad and the Odyssey
Odysseus
king of Ithaca
Penelope
wife of Odysseus
Telemachus
son of Odysseus
Calypso
sea nymph who keeps Odysseus captive for 10 years
Naussicaa
princess of the island of Scheria
Lotus Eaters
made food that would cause forgetfulness
Cyclops called Polyphemus
Poseidon's son
The Bag of Wind
opened by Odysseus's crew and blew them off course
Circe
witch who turned men into pigs
Teiresias
blind seer
Sirens
their song made men kill themselves
Scylla
6 headed monster
Charybdis
whirlpool
